    Pendleton’s Loss: Noah J. Lindsey Killed on Interstate 84 Crossing

    On the chilly morning of December 22, 25‑year‑old Noah J. Lindsey of Pendleton lost his life in a heartbreaking crash on Interstate 84 near milepost 207, an event that has cast a long shadow over his community.

    Emergency responders were called to the scene just before 7:50 a.m. after Oregon State Police reported that Noah was struck by an eastbound Kenworth commercial truck and trailer while he was attempting to cross the interstate. The driver, identified as 55‑year‑old Ben Travis Johnson of Kennewick, Washington, remained at the scene and was not injured.

    Despite rapid response and efforts by first responders, Noah was pronounced dead at the site of the collision. The interstate was closed and affected for about four hours as investigators and transportation crews worked quietly, a somber pause that mirrored the community’s pain.

    This tragic accident has also raised conversations in the region about highway safety and pedestrian risks along busy rural interstates like I‑84. Interstate 84 is the main east‑west highway through eastern Oregon and carries heavy commercial and commuter traffic, especially in Umatilla County where weather and speed can make the road unforgiving.

    Authorities continue to remind drivers to stay vigilant and pedestrians to avoid crossing high‑speed roadways whenever possible. For many in Pendleton, the crash is a stark reminder of how fragile life can be and how quickly a community can be changed by one moment.
